Поделиться через


VpnConnections interface

Интерфейс, представляющий VPNConnections.

Методы

beginCreateOrUpdate(string, string, string, VpnConnection, VpnConnectionsCreateOrUpdateOptionalParams)

Создает vpn-подключение к масштабируемому VPN-шлюзу, если он еще не существует, обновляет существующее подключение.

beginCreateOrUpdateAndWait(string, string, string, VpnConnection, VpnConnectionsCreateOrUpdateOptionalParams)

Создает vpn-подключение к масштабируемому VPN-шлюзу, если он еще не существует, обновляет существующее подключение.

beginDelete(string, string, string, VpnConnectionsDeleteOptionalParams)

Удаляет VPN-подключение.

beginDeleteAndWait(string, string, string, VpnConnectionsDeleteOptionalParams)

Удаляет VPN-подключение.

beginStartPacketCapture(string, string, string, VpnConnectionsStartPacketCaptureOptionalParams)

Запускает запись пакетов в vpn-подключении в указанной группе ресурсов.

beginStartPacketCaptureAndWait(string, string, string, VpnConnectionsStartPacketCaptureOptionalParams)

Запускает запись пакетов в vpn-подключении в указанной группе ресурсов.

beginStopPacketCapture(string, string, string, VpnConnectionsStopPacketCaptureOptionalParams)

Останавливает запись пакетов в vpn-подключении в указанной группе ресурсов.

beginStopPacketCaptureAndWait(string, string, string, VpnConnectionsStopPacketCaptureOptionalParams)

Останавливает запись пакетов в vpn-подключении в указанной группе ресурсов.

get(string, string, string, VpnConnectionsGetOptionalParams)

Извлекает сведения о VPN-подключении.

listByVpnGateway(string, string, VpnConnectionsListByVpnGatewayOptionalParams)

Извлекает все VPN-подключения для определенного VPN-шлюза виртуальной глобальной сети.

Сведения о методе

beginCreateOrUpdate(string, string, string, VpnConnection, VpnConnectionsCreateOrUpdateOptionalParams)

Создает vpn-подключение к масштабируемому VPN-шлюзу, если он еще не существует, обновляет существующее подключение.

function beginCreateOrUpdate(resourceGroupName: string, gatewayName: string, connectionName: string, vpnConnectionParameters: VpnConnection, options?: VpnConnections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<VpnConnection>, VpnConnection>>

Параметры

resourceGroupName

string

Имя группы ресурсов VpnGateway.

gatewayName

string

Имя шлюза.

connectionName

string

Имя подключения.

vpnConnectionParameters
VpnConnection

Параметры, предоставленные для создания или обновления VPN-подключения.

options
VpnConnectionsC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<VpnConnection>, VpnConnection>>

beginCreateOrUpdateAndWait(string, string, string, VpnConnection, VpnConnectionsCreateOrUpdateOptionalParams)

Создает vpn-подключение к масштабируемому VPN-шлюзу, если он еще не существует, обновляет существующее подключение.

function beginCreateOrUpdateAndWait(resourceGroupName: string, gatewayName: string, connectionName: string, vpnConnectionParameters: VpnConnection, options?: VpnConnectionsCreateOrUpdateOptionalParams): Promise<VpnConnection>

Параметры

resourceGroupName

string

Имя группы ресурсов VpnGateway.

gatewayName

string

Имя шлюза.

connectionName

string

Имя подключения.

vpnConnectionParameters
VpnConnection

Параметры, предоставленные для создания или обновления VPN-подключения.

options
VpnConnectionsCreateOrUpdateO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<VpnConnection>

beginDelete(string, string, string, VpnConnectionsDeleteOptionalParams)

Удаляет VPN-подключение.

function beginDelete(resourceGroupName: string, gatewayName: string, connectionName: string, options?: VpnConnections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Параметры

resourceGroupName

string

Имя группы ресурсов VpnGateway.

gatewayName

string

Имя шлюза.

connectionName

string

Имя подключения.

options
VpnConnectionsD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, VpnConnectionsDeleteOptionalParams)

Удаляет VPN-подключение.

function beginDeleteAndWait(resourceGroupName: string, gatewayName: string, connectionName: string, options?: VpnConnectionsDeleteOptionalParams): Promise<void>

Параметры

resourceGroupName

string

Имя группы ресурсов VpnGateway.

gatewayName

string

Имя шлюза.

connectionName

string

Имя подключения.

options
VpnConnectionsDeleteO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<void>

beginStartPacketCapture(string, string, string, VpnConnectionsStartPacketCaptureOptionalParams)

Запускает запись пакетов в vpn-подключении в указанной группе ресурсов.

function beginStartPacketCapture(resourceGroupName: string, gatewayName: string, vpnConnectionName: string, options?: VpnConnectionsStartPacketCaptureOptionalParams): Promise<SimplePollerLike<OperationState<VpnConnectionsStartPacketCaptureResponse>, VpnConnectionsStartPacketCaptureResponse>>

Параметры

resourceGroupName

string

Имя группы ресурсов.

gatewayName

string

Имя шлюза.

vpnConnectionName

string

Имя VPN-подключения.

options
VpnConnectionsStartPacketCaptureOptionalParams

Параметры параметров.

Возвращаемое значение

beginStartPacketCaptureAndWait(string, string, string, VpnConnectionsStartPacketCaptureOptionalParams)

Запускает запись пакетов в vpn-подключении в указанной группе ресурсов.

function beginStartPacketCaptureAndWait(resourceGroupName: string, gatewayName: string, vpnConnectionName: string, options?: VpnConnectionsStartPacketCaptureOptionalParams): Promise<VpnConnectionsStartPacketCaptureRes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ов.

gatewayName

string

Имя шлюза.

vpnConnectionName

string

Имя VPN-подключения.

options
VpnConnectionsStartPacketCaptureOptionalParams

Параметры параметров.

Возвращаемое значение

beginStopPacketCapture(string, string, string, VpnConnectionsStopPacketCaptureOptionalParams)

Останавливает запись пакетов в vpn-подключении в указанной группе ресурсов.

function beginStopPacketCapture(resourceGroupName: string, gatewayName: string, vpnConnectionName: string, options?: VpnConnectionsStopPacketCaptureOptionalParams): Promise<SimplePollerLike<OperationState<VpnConnectionsStopPacketCaptureResponse>, VpnConnectionsStopPacketCaptureResponse>>

Параметры

resourceGroupName

string

Имя группы ресурсов.

gatewayName

string

Имя шлюза.

vpnConnectionName

string

Имя VPN-подключения.

options
VpnConnectionsStopPacketCaptureOptionalParams

Параметры параметров.

Возвращаемое значение

beginStopPacketCaptureAndWait(string, string, string, VpnConnectionsStopPacketCaptureOptionalParams)

Останавливает запись пакетов в vpn-подключении в указанной группе ресурсов.

function beginStopPacketCaptureAndWait(resourceGroupName: string, gatewayName: string, vpnConnectionName: string, options?: VpnConnectionsStopPacketCaptureOptionalParams): Promise<VpnConnectionsStopPacketCaptureRes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ов.

gatewayName

string

Имя шлюза.

vpnConnectionName

string

Имя VPN-подключения.

options
VpnConnectionsStopPacketCaptureOptionalParams

Параметры параметров.

Возвращаемое значение

get(string, string, string, VpnConnectionsGetOptionalParams)

Извлекает сведения о VPN-подключении.

function get(resourceGroupName: string, gatewayName: string, connectionName: string, options?: VpnConnectionsGetOptionalParams): Promise<VpnConnection>

Параметры

resourceGroupName

string

Имя группы ресурсов VpnGateway.

gatewayName

string

Имя шлюза.

connectionName

string

Имя VPN-подключения.

options
VpnConnectionsGetOptionalParams

Параметры параметров.

Возвращаемое значение

Promise<VpnConnection>

listByVpnGateway(string, string, VpnConnectionsListByVpnGatewayOptionalParams)

Извлекает все VPN-подключения для определенного VPN-шлюза виртуальной глобальной сети.

function listByVpnGateway(resourceGroupName: string, gatewayName: string, options?: VpnConnectionsListByVpnGatewayOptionalParams): PagedAsyncIterableIterator<VpnConnection, VpnConnection[], PageSettings>

Параметры

resourceGroupName

string

Имя группы ресурсов VpnGateway.

gatewayName

string

Имя шлюза.

options
VpnConnectionsListByVpnGatewayOptionalParams

Параметры параметров.

Возвращаемое значение